West Indies hosted the second edition of the Women's T20 World Cup. Australia made the first of their five consecutive final appearances here, of which they have won four.
Despite making it to the semi-final four times, New Zealand have never won the trophy. As in 2018, they have been bracketed with Australia and India.
The inaugural women's edition was played men's edition, in England in 2009. England won the tournament with a 6-wicket win against New Zealand in the final.
